# Break-Glass: Catalog Cache Invalidation

Scope: the Pinrow product catalog at Veldstone Retail. If stale prices persist after a purge and the Hollowmere invalidation queue is wedged, use break-glass to flush the edge tier directly. Contractors: get verbal sign-off from the catalog lead first. Steps: open the Hollowmere admin shell, select emergency-flush, confirm the tenant, and run it once — repeated flushes thrash the origin. Access is logged and expires after 20 minutes. Unseal the admin shell with the passphrase below.

recovery phrase for kahop-tajog: istix-casvan

# Service Accounts: Billing Worker Blue-Green

Quick notes for the eng sync: the Tallow billing worker now runs blue-green, and each color gets its own service account so we can cut traffic over without credential clashes. The green slot was provisioned this week and needs its key wired in. Here it is.

app token of yajeg-kawef = kto11_7En3XSX8xQw

## Changelog — Lorekeep wiki, release 4.2

Renamed setting: ROLE_GATE_TOKEN is now ACCESS_SIGNER_KEY, reflecting its actual use by the role-based access signer rather than the gate middleware. The old name is still read for two releases with a deprecation warning in logs. Deploys after 4.4 will fail if only the old name is present. Update your env files now; the new entry and its value follow on the next line.

vault entry, yahif-yajep: COURIER_KEY29=b802bdf8034096b65a51c6ba5abe2